Frequent Challenges in Relationship Therapy

Couples commonly turn to counseling upon experiencing continuous problems that obstruct their partnership. Frequent problems encompass communication disruptions, where partners have trouble articulating their sentiments or misconstrue each other. Trust issues frequently arise from past betrayals or insecurities, leading to emotional distance. Many relationships also contend with divergent beliefs or objectives, producing discord and unhappiness. Intimacy challenges, be they emotional or physical, may additionally intensify strain, resulting in one or both individuals feeling unsatisfied.

Conflict resolution skills often need refinement, as unresolved arguments can spiral into resentment. Money-related strain is an additional widespread concern, influencing routine communication and extended planning. Furthermore, outside demands from relatives or employment can stress the relationship. Identifying these frequent challenges is crucial, since they typically act as motivators for pursuing expert assistance, enabling a more profound comprehension of both partners' requirements and promoting improved relational patterns.

Reviewing Professional Background And Experience

How do couples make certain they pick the right counselor for their individual needs? Examining qualifications and experience is critical in this decision-making process. Couples should prioritize counselors who hold appropriate degrees in psychology, social work, or counseling, as these credentials show a foundational knowledge of relationship dynamics. In addition, specialized training in couples therapy, such as Emotionally Focused Therapy or the Gottman Method, can boost the counselor's effectiveness. Experience counts, too; a counselor with a demonstrated track record in successfully addressing similar issues can provide individualized guidance. Couples should also consider seeking reviews or testimonials, verifying the counselor's approach corresponds to their values and expectations. In the end, a thorough evaluation of qualifications and experience sets the stage for a productive counseling journey.

Exploring Counseling Methods

While maneuvering through the complexities of relationships, couples often discover that the technique a counselor employs can substantially influence their therapeutic journey. Different counseling methodologies exist, including Emotionally Focused Therapy (EFT),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), and Imago Relationship Therapy. Each presents unique strategies tailored to different needs. For instance, EFT focuses on emotional bonding, while CBT emphasizes changing negative thought patterns. Couples should consider their specific challenges—communication issues, trust deficits, or differing values—when selecting a counselor. A good match can enhance engagement and foster positive outcomes. Ultimately, understanding these approaches allows couples to make informed decisions, guaranteeing that their counseling experience corresponds with their personal goals and relationship dynamics.

What You Should Expect During Your First Couples Counseling Session?

Beginning a couples counseling session for the first time can evoke a mix of apprehension and curiosity. Couples may be curious about the structure of the session and what the counselor will inquire about. Typically, the initial meeting focuses on building a safe environment, permitting both partners to share their concerns and feelings. The counselor may ask each person to share their perspective on the relationship, promoting open communication.

Plan to review the relationship's journey, including positive experiences and challenges. This exploration enables the counselor recognize underlying issues. The couple may also set goals for therapy, outlining what they wish to attain. Throughout the session, the counselor will facilitate dialogue, ensuring that both partners feel valued and understood. All in all, the first session acts as a foundation for future discussions, helping couples recognize the value of counseling in steering their relationship challenges.

How Long Do Couples Counseling Sessions Typically Continue?

Marriage counseling usually spans between six to twelve sessions, contingent upon the particular concerns and goals. Each session usually lasts around 50 minutes, giving couples to examine their concerns and develop stronger communication strategies.

Is Couples Therapy Effective for Long-Distance Relationships?

Couples therapy can work well for relationships spanning distances, as it presents methods for conflict management and better communication. Therapists can help partners manage particular issues, nurturing an emotional bond in spite of physical separation, in the end enhancing relationship satisfaction.

What Happens When One Partner Won't Participate in Counseling?

If one partner is not willing to attend counseling, progress may stall. The other partner can nonetheless pursue individual therapy, fostering personal growth and gaining perspectives that might encourage change or open communication in the relationship.

Do Couples Counselors Use Specific Techniques?

Marriage counseling implements multiple methods, including active listening, communication exercises, role-play scenarios, and disagreement resolution methods. These approaches seek to enhance comprehension, encourage empathy, and strengthen interpersonal interactions, consequently leading partners in the direction of more positive interactions and resolutions.

How Do We Monitor Our Progress in Counseling?

Development in counseling can be evaluated through strengthened communication, diminished conflict frequency, enhanced emotional intimacy, and the effective implementation of coping strategies. Regular feedback sessions with the counselor also provide insight into each partner's advancement.
